Job Description
As a Gameplay Animator at Ubisoft Montreal, you will be responsible for creating animations and animation systems for the first-person main character, as well as the corresponding replication animations for the third-person view.
What you will do:
- Create first-person animations aligned with the visual language defined by the animation direction and game design constraints.
- Produce high-quality keyframe animations based on various video references.
- Process and enhance motion capture data, used as a foundation for certain animation systems.
- Adjust animation data with high precision, taking into account the requirements of the game engine.
- Export and integrate animations according to technical guidelines, in collaboration with technical direction, technical animation, programming, and design.
- Test, analyze, and revise animation systems directly in-game.
- Collaborate closely with other animators, animation direction, programming, and design to deliver work that meets quality and schedule objectives.
- Take responsibility for the final in-game feel, a key criterion for evaluating animation quality.
Qualifications
- Solid experience in gameplay animation for video games.
- Proven expertise in 3C animation and first-person (FPS) animation systems.
- Excellent mastery of motion capture data processing.
- A keen eye for detail and a high standard for visual quality.
- A collaborative and open approach, favoring the search for compromises when facing complex issues.
- An ability to demonstrate flexibility and manage adjustments related to production.
- A good understanding of the technical constraints related to integration into a game engine.
- Comfort working in a multidisciplinary environment, while respecting artistic and technical visions.
- Knowledge of MotionBuilder is considered an asset.
- Participation in a shipped AAA game is a plus.
